Disappearing Pixels on dash display.

We bought a 540i back in the spring with 97,000 miles. The piwel displayed just below the tach and speedo are disappearing. It is a challenge to make out the mileage. I had heard a few references to the fact that BMWNA will rpelace the part but not the labor to install. Just before we bought this car we had the local BMW dealer do a "Pre-purchase Inspection". The pixel display was one of the issues on the inspection. I will have to look back at that inspection, but I am just about positive that they listed the part and labor to fix the display. The part was around $600-$700.

What do I need to do to get BMWNA to replace the part? Is this a job that I can do if I get my hands on the part? I give myself 3 1/2 wrenches out of a possible 5 wrenches.

Jakers,
Do a search under "pixels", "dashboard"... We have covered this many times. The unit you're talking about is a little more difficult to replace but can be done if you take your time. I had mine done at the dealer for around $400.
Check www.BMRPARTS.com or call them. They may have a unit in stock.
Also, as a reference check www.realoem.com It shows you how to assemble/disassemble parts & their part numbers.
